  • Introduction to Remote IoT

    Remote IoT refers to the use of internet-connected devices to collect, process, and transmit data from remote locations. This technology has transformed industries by enabling real-time monitoring, automation, and data-driven decision-making. Remote IoT systems are particularly valuable in scenarios where physical access is limited or impractical, such as in remote agricultural fields, offshore oil rigs, or smart city infrastructure.

    The key components of a remote IoT system include sensors, microcontrollers, communication modules, and cloud platforms. Sensors collect data from the environment, microcontrollers process the data, and communication modules transmit it to the cloud. Cloud platforms, such as VPCs, provide a secure and scalable environment for storing and analyzing the data. By integrating these components, businesses can gain valuable insights and improve operational efficiency.

    Understanding Virtual Private Clouds (VPC) for IoT

    A Virtual Private Cloud (VPC) is a secure and isolated virtual network hosted within a public cloud provider's infrastructure. VPCs are particularly useful for IoT applications because they provide enhanced security, scalability, and control over network resources. By integrating VPCs with Raspberry Pi, you can create a robust and secure IoT infrastructure that supports remote connectivity.

    Benefits of Using VPC for IoT

    • Enhanced Security: VPCs isolate your IoT devices and data from the public internet, reducing the risk of cyberattacks.
    • Scalability: VPCs can easily scale to accommodate growing numbers of IoT devices and data.
    • Customization: You can configure network settings, IP addresses, and security policies to meet your specific requirements.

    Step-by-Step Guide to Setting Up Raspberry Pi for Remote IoT

    Setting up Raspberry Pi for remote IoT applications involves several steps, including hardware preparation, software installation, and network configuration. Below is a detailed guide to help you get started.

  • Step 1: Hardware Setup

    Begin by assembling the necessary hardware components, including the Raspberry Pi board, power supply, microSD card, and peripherals such as sensors and communication modules. Ensure that all components are compatible with your project requirements.

    Step 2: Installing the Operating System

    Download and install the Raspberry Pi OS (formerly Raspbian) onto the microSD card. You can use tools like Raspberry Pi Imager to simplify the installation process. Once the OS is installed, connect the Raspberry Pi to a monitor, keyboard, and mouse for initial configuration.

    Step 3: Network Configuration

    Configure the Raspberry Pi to connect to your local network or a remote VPC. This may involve setting up Wi-Fi, Ethernet, or cellular connectivity, depending on your project requirements. Use tools like SSH to remotely access and manage the Raspberry Pi.

    Integrating VPC with Raspberry Pi for Enhanced Security

    Integrating a VPC with Raspberry Pi involves configuring the VPC to communicate securely with the Raspberry Pi. This can be achieved using VPNs, firewalls, and access control policies. Below are the key steps to integrate VPC with Raspberry Pi.

    Step 1: Setting Up the VPC

    Create a VPC using a cloud provider such as AWS, Google Cloud, or Azure. Configure the VPC with the necessary subnets, routing tables, and security groups. Ensure that the VPC is isolated from the public internet to enhance security.

    Step 2: Establishing Secure Connections

    Use a VPN to establish a secure connection between the Raspberry Pi and the VPC. Configure the VPN settings on both the Raspberry Pi and the VPC to ensure seamless communication. Additionally, implement firewalls and access control policies to restrict unauthorized access.

    Cost-Effective Solutions for Remote IoT VPC Raspberry Pi

    Building a remote IoT system using Raspberry Pi and VPC can be cost-effective if done correctly. Below are some strategies to minimize costs while maximizing the benefits of your IoT project.

    1. Use Free or Low-Cost Cloud Services

    Many cloud providers offer free tiers or low-cost plans for VPCs and IoT services. For example, AWS Free Tier provides 750 hours of EC2 usage per month, which can be sufficient for small-scale IoT projects.

    2. Optimize Hardware Usage

    Use energy-efficient components and optimize the Raspberry Pi's power consumption to reduce operational costs. Additionally, consider using open-source software to minimize licensing fees.

    Challenges and Solutions in Remote IoT Implementation

    While remote IoT systems offer numerous benefits, they also present several challenges. Below are some common challenges and their solutions.

    Challenge 1: Security Risks

    IoT devices are often vulnerable to cyberattacks. To mitigate this risk, use VPCs to isolate your IoT devices and data from the public internet. Additionally, implement strong authentication and encryption protocols.

    Challenge 2: Scalability Issues

    As the number of IoT devices grows, managing and scaling the infrastructure can become challenging. Use cloud-based VPCs to easily scale your IoT system and accommodate growing data volumes.
